			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<div class='wb_fb_top'><div style="float:right;"></div></div><p>Bandit was put to sleep the day after Xmas 2007. (<a href="http://chwalisz.org/2007/12/28/au-revoir-bandit/">See</a>).</p>
<ol>
<li>I have no reason to rush home after work. Well, my wife, Bette, I suppose, but she gets home later&#8230; I would let him up, and we would go out and get the mail, come in, get his dinner. It was a fine life.</li>
<li>The dog bed is empty. Soon it will be given away.</li>
<li>I don&#8217;t have anyone to go do errands with. Bandit loved the car, even though he would bark until I came back.</li>
<li>A dog is inherently male. He burps when he wants, farts as necessary (much to Bette&#8217;s dismay) and eats whatever he can get a hold of. He loves unconditionally, is kind to all, but defends his turf when necessary. A fine way to live. We &#8220;civilized&#8221; humans should take note.</li>
<li>He was Sarah&#8217;s dog, so in a way, he is our last living link to Sarah &#8212; other than her mom, her friends and her family.</li>
<li>Bette liked having him there to talk to or yell at. Now she has to yell at me.</li>
<li>His smell. Sometimes I just put my nose in his fur and sniffed. Bette says that is what she missed most about Sarah. Dogs just smell warm and friendly.</li>
